Effects of ZnSO4 and Fe2O3 Nanoparticles of Lentil (Lens culinaris) on the Antioxidant System, Agronomic, Physiologic, and Root Characteristics under Drought Stress
Extended Abstract Background: Lentil (Lens culinaris Medik.) is one of the main food legume crops in Iran, where it is grown as a rainfed crop in spring in cold regions.
